Another common myth is that all individuals who gamble have an addiction. While gambling addiction is a serious issue affecting a subset of players, the majority of individuals who gamble do so recreationally and responsibly. Many people enjoy gambling as a form of entertainment, much like going to a movie or dining out.
It is essential to differentiate between casual gambling and problematic gambling behaviors. Responsible gambling practices, such as setting limits and knowing when to stop, can help mitigate risks. Understanding that not all gamblers struggle with addiction can encourage a healthier perspective on the activity.
A prevalent belief is that casinos manipulate their games to guarantee that players will lose. In reality, licensed and regulated casinos must adhere to strict rules and regulations to ensure fair play. Most games are designed with a built-in house edge, but this does not equate to manipulation; instead, it reflects the mathematical probabilities involved in each game.
Additionally, gaming regulators conduct audits to verify that the games are fair and that payouts are in line with industry standards. Understanding the mechanics of how games work can help demystify the notion of manipulation and reassure players that they are participating in a fair environment.
